Parshas Shemos is the first parsha in the Book of Shemos and the start of the six or eight weeks of Shovavim. It contains 124 pesukim. Ashkinazim read a section of Yeshayahu for the Haftora and the Sefardim read from the first chapter of Yirmiya.

Enslavement of the Jews

Passing of the Tribes

The Tribes pass away. The Torah counts the Tribes after their passing as a display of affection although they were counted already during their life.

Multiplying of the Jews

At that point many of the Jewish woman began to give birth to sextuplets, greatly multiplying their population. Unlike rare recent history cases of sextuplet births where a portion of the children are generally born impaired and die soon afterwords, these were common and all 6 would emerge healthy and survive.

New King

This new Pharaoh had still recognized Yosef and his accomplishments for Egypt, yet chose to ignored this and issued his evil decrees.

The Plan

Terrified that the multiplying Jews would take over the land, Pharaoh and his advisers devise a plan to enslave them.

Drowning of the Males

Pharaoh commands the head midwives to kill all first born males. They do not listen to him and continue to let them live. Hashem rewards Yocheved and Miriam by promising to originate the houses of royalty, Kohanim and Levim from their descendants. Seeing his original plan failed, Pharaoh commands the Egyptians to drown all newborn males.

History of Moshe

Remarriage of Amram

At the advise of his daughter Miriam, Amram remarries Yocheved, causing the entire nation to follow suite and return their divorced wives.

Moshe is Born

Hiding

Moshe is hidden in the house for three months.

In Nile

Yocheved creates a small ark, puts Moshe inside and leaves him in the Nile.
